FBS Pricing

Worried about unexpected trading costs?

FBS pricing offers a range of account types, providing transparent costs tailored to different trading styles and experience levels, from beginners to advanced traders.

Plan Price & Features
Cent Account Minimum deposit $1-5
• Designed for beginners
• Micro-lot trading
• Fixed spreads from 3 pips
• No commissions
Standard Account Minimum deposit $5
• Spreads from 0.7 pips
• Commission-free trading
• Rollover fees apply
• Suitable for intermediate traders
Zero Spread Account Commissions from $20 per lot
• Fixed spreads of 0 pips
• High-volume trading
• Suitable for scalpers
ECN Account Commissions from $6 per lot
• Variable spreads
• Fast market execution
• Access to liquidity providers
Islamic Account Spreads from 0.7 pips
• Swap-free (no rollover fees)
• Adheres to Sharia principles
• Available across account types

1. XM

Do you need more trading instruments?

XM generally offers a broader selection of trading instruments and superior research materials, appealing to traders seeking diverse portfolios. From my competitive analysis, XM offers lower overnight holding costs for leveraged positions, an advantage over FBS for long-term strategies.

Choose XM if you require wider instrument variety, lower swap rates, or more in-depth research to support your trading.

2. Exness

Prioritizing ultra-low costs and execution speed?

Exness stands out for its cost-efficiency and advanced trading conditions, making it ideal for high-frequency strategies like scalping. What I found comparing options is that Exness provides significantly lower trading fees and instant withdrawals, which is crucial for active traders.

Consider this alternative when you prioritize ultra-low costs, fast execution, and a broader instrument range for experienced trading.

3. IC Markets

Are you a high-volume or scalping trader?

IC Markets is known for its ultra-low trading fees and significantly wider range of markets, including futures and options. From my analysis, IC Markets offers the lowest spreads and commissions for high-volume traders, differing from FBS’s beginner-friendly focus.

Choose IC Markets if you are a high-volume trader or scalper seeking the absolute lowest costs and a vast array of instruments.

4. eToro

Interested in social trading and real stock investments?

eToro is primarily known for its integrated social trading and copy trading features, plus access to real stocks and ETFs, not just CFDs. Alternative-wise, eToro excels in user-friendliness for social trading, while FBS focuses more on advanced MT4/MT5 capabilities.

Choose eToro if your primary interest is copying other traders or investing in real stocks in addition to CFDs.
